M/I Homes, Inc. (MHO), along with its affiliated companies, constructs single-family residences across a broad geographical area, including Ohio, Indiana, Illinois, Minnesota, Michigan, Florida, Texas, North Carolina, and Tennessee. Its operations are divided into three primary segments: Northern Homebuilding, Southern Homebuilding, and Financial Services. Under the M/I Homes brand, the company engages in the entire process of home development, from conceptual design and construction to marketing and sales. It caters to a diverse clientele, encompassing first-time purchasers, millennials, those upgrading their homes, empty-nesters, and luxury market consumers, offering both detached single-family houses and attached townhouses. Beyond building, M/I Homes acquires raw land, transforming it into ready-to-build lots. These developed parcels are then utilized for its own single-family home construction projects or sold to external parties. Furthermore, its financial services division facilitates homeownership by originating and selling mortgage loans. This segment also operates as a title insurance provider, offering policies, conducting examinations, and managing closing services for individuals buying M/I Homes properties. Originally established in Columbus, Ohio, in 1976, the company was initially named M/I Schottenstein Homes, Inc. It adopted its current name, M/I Homes, Inc., in January 2004.
